Mike, or anyone.
Are disc brakes prohibited in all cyclocross events or just certain sanctioned events?
|
|
|
Post by Mike S on Oct 1, 2009 16:41:19 GMT -8
Disc brakes are against UCI 'cross rules. Local races usually don't enforce the rule.

I'm not sure what they did at Starcrossed this year, but in a lot of regional races, they only enforce the UCI rules in the UCI categories of the race. That is, the Pro12 races at Starcrossed, USGP and so on. Thats why you also see mountain bikes being used at Starcrossed in the lower (non UCI) cats. Locally here in Spokane, it's up to the local officials (namely Marla) as to how to enforce the rules. It looks like Marla is partially using UCI rules for the A's and B's because she says "700c" wheels only. But I'm guessing she will allow disc brakes this year.
